Algebra 2 & Trig Course Description
(Back)
Algebra 2 & Trig Grade
11 - Full year
- One credit
This is the third course of the New York State
mathematics curriculum. Mathematical concepts are
extended in the areas of rational expressions,
radical expressions, equations/inequalities dealing
with absolute values, transformations, geometry,
probability, and statistics. Also provided is the
study of complex numbers, relations and functions
including composition, inverse, exponential
functions, logarithmic functions, and the six
trigonometric functions. Graphing calculators will
be used throughout the year. Students will take the
Math-B Regents exam or the Algebra 2 & Trig Regents
exam upon completion of this course.
